Silver Cane Limousines

Comments on Silver Cane Limousines. 53 St. Wilfrids Road, Bessacarr, Doncaster, South Brent , South Yorkshire, DN46AB UK
Please share as much information as you can about Silver Cane Limousines so other users can benefit from your comment.
Can't read?